Reuknight has a pink and purple face, a triangular rosy nose, and two flags on his backside which is predominantly white but has two hollow blue circles and a colored spot near the top. He holds a katana sword at his hip and always holds a Jumonji yari spear in his right hand. His armor his mostly blue and crested with yellow at most edges, wearing shoulder pads obviously on his shoulders along with having a purple tie at his waist to hold his sword. He wears a typical shogun kabuto helmet with a yellow moon crest in the middle with a crack in the center and tips, a navy article clothing similar to that of his pants and socks, and golden-yellow zori sandals. Two large aqua blue wisps can be seen on each side of his shoulders.
Reuknight is the combined form of Helmsman and Armsman.
White Reuknight is identical to his colored counterpart except that his body is white and that he follows McKraken's evil issues.

In the anime[]
Reuknight was first summoned in the 1st movie as part of Nathaniel's team against Dame Dedtime. Reuknight was saved from drowning by Nathaniel and considers him an ally and friend.
Etymology[]
"Reuknight" is a portmanteau of reunite and knight.
"Genma Shogun" is a portmanteau of genma (Japanese: 幻魔,"phantom") and shogun.
"Uniguerriero" is a portmanteau of unito (united) and guerriero (warrior).
"Hybritter" is a portmanteau of hybrid and Ritter (knight).
"Juntollero" is a portmanteau of juntos (together) and caballero (knight).
"Bushidos" is a portmanteau of bushido and dos (Spanish for "two").
Trivia[]
Reuknight's random nicknames in Yo-kai Watch are: Ted, Wayne, Peaches and Scraps.
Reuknight's wisps are actually sentient shown by one of his unlockable victory poses.
His wisps may also be symbolism for him being made of Helmsman and Armsman. (Two Souls, two wisps)
Despite having a normal medal in the game, he has a Z medal in the anime.
There is a possible connection from Reuknight drowning in the first Yo-kai Watch movie and his debut in the anime having to do with swimming.
Reuknight is the "final boss" of the Yo-kai Watch demo
